Job Overview:

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Software Developer with expertise in Big Data and Graph Database technologies. This role involves working closely with customers, business analysts, and team members to understand business requirements and design quality technical solutions.

The ideal candidate will be responsible for the full software development lifecycle, including design, coding, testing, implementation, maintenance, and support of application software—all while aligning with the organization’s IT and business strategies.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with customers and business analysts to understand and translate business requirements into technical solutions.
  • Take part in the design, coding, testing, and implementation of application software while ensuring compliance with the organization’s architectural standards.
  • Contribute to enhancements of the ROCI Big Data platform and its syndication capabilities through:
  • Development on NEO4J Graph Database.
  • Databricks ETL pipeline development.
  • AWS pipeline automation.
  • Working with ECS, EKS, and Django-based APIs.
  • Data engineering tasks.
  • Provide guidance and recommendations for new code development or the reuse of existing code.
  • Participate in component and data architecture design, performance monitoring, and evaluating build-versus-buy decisions.
  • Monitor and ensure performance of software solutions.

Qualifications:

Education: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field—or equivalent work experience.

Experience:

  • Minimum of 10+ years of experience in programming and systems analysis.

Technical Skills:

  • Proficient in NEO4J Graph Database.
  • Hands-on experience with Databricks for ETL workflows.
  • Expertise in AWS pipeline automation (ECS/EKS).
  • Strong knowledge of Django-based APIs.
  • Solid experience in data engineering.
  • In-depth understanding of systems analysis, design, development, testing, and integration methodologies.

Working Arrangements:

  • This is an on-site position, requiring the candidate to work in the Philadelphia office 4 days per week.
